Output 62ec5897891f9521b3fd16785d7d55dbb74a1925a8528cc4678e74ce9416306d:0

value
3106
script pubkey
OP_0 OP_PUSHBYTES_32 700f9441964587117241d47ecbde6161b61d5c86677686d8a0acf6e7b9bcca03
address
bc1qwq8egsvkgkr3zujp63lvhhnpvxmp6hyxvamgdk9q4nmw0wduegpsx6w4am
transaction
62ec5897891f9521b3fd16785d7d55dbb74a1925a8528cc4678e74ce9416306d